What Coupon Stacking Really Means at Kohl’s

Stacking means using multiple discounts on the same items in one transaction. Most stores limit you to one coupon. Kohl’s allows you to use three different types at the same time, as long as they are different. This is the main reason shoppers can walk out paying 60-70% less than the original price.

The Three Coupon Types You Can Combine

Kohl’s divides discounts into clear categories. You may use only one from each:

  1. Dollar-off coupons Examples: $10 off $50, $15 off $75, $20 off $100 home, $5 off $25 toys. These have a minimum purchase amount and may only apply to certain departments.

  2. Percentage-off coupons Examples: 15% off, 20% off, 25% off, 30% off, or rare 35% off and 40% off. These can be store-wide or limited to specific categories like shoes or jewelry.

  3. Kohl’s Cash: This is the red certificate or digital credit you earn ($10 for every $50 spent during earn periods). It works like cash during redemption dates and can be used on almost anything.

Important: Free shipping codes and Kohl’s Rewards 5% do NOT count toward the three-coupon limit. You can always add those on top.

The Exact Order That Saves the Most Money

The order in which you apply coupons changes the final price. Always follow this sequence:

Step 1. Dollar-off coupon first

Reason: It lowers the total before the percentage is calculated.

Example: $100 cart → $10 off $50 → new total $90.

Step 2. Percentage-off coupon second

Reason: The Percentage now calculates on $90 instead of $100.

Example: 30% off $90 = $27 saved → new total $63.

Step 3. Kohl’s Cash last

Reason: Kohl’s Cash subtracts dollar-for-dollar from the final amount.

Example: $30 Kohl’s Cash → pay only $33 out of pocket.

Shopping Example from November 2025

Items like KitchenAid mixer $249.99, towels $50, shirts $60 → total $359.99

  • Used $50 off $200 home purchase → $309.99

  • Used 30% off coupon (from Kohl’s Card) → $309.99 × 0.30 = $92.99 off → $217.00

  • Used $100 Kohl’s Cash earned last week → paid $117.00 Original price $359.99 → paid $117.00 → saved 67% Plus earned $50 new Kohl’s Cash for next time.

How to Stack Kohl’s Coupon Codes Online - Step by Step

  1. Shop on Kohls.com or the Kohl’s app.

  2. Add everything to your cart.

  3. Click the cart icon → “Checkout”.

  4. Scroll to the “Kohl’s Cash & Promos” box (below the order summary).

  5. Type or paste the dollars-off code first → click “Apply”.

  6. Type the percentage-off code second → click “Apply”.

  7. If you have Kohl’s Cash, it shows automatically; check the box to use it.

  8. Add free shipping code if needed (example: MVCFREESHIP).

  9. Watch the total drop with every click.

In-Store Stacking Process

Hand coupons to the cashier in this order:

  1. Dollars-off coupon

  2. Percentage-off coupon

  3. Kohl’s Cash

  4. Scan your Kohl’s Rewards barcode for 5% back. Cashiers know the system; if something does not work, politely ask them to enter it manually.

Extra Ways to Save on Top of Stacking

  • Shop during triple Kohl’s Cash events (usually July, October, December).

  • Buy gift cards during earn periods to get Kohl’s Cash on the gift card amount.

  • Use price matching if you find the same item cheaper elsewhere.

  • Return items bought with Kohl’s Cash; you keep the Cash if used correctly.

  • Combine with clearance: 80-90% off clearance + stacking = almost free items.

Common Mistakes That Cost You Money

  • Entering percentage code before dollars-off (loses $5-$20 every time).

  • Forgetting to click “Apply” after each code.

  • Using Kohl’s Cash on excluded brands (system rejects).

  • Throwing away paper, take a photo as a backup with Kohl's Cash.

  • Shopping without a Rewards account, you miss 5% forever.
